Show / Hide Table of Contents

Class IndicatorDto

Базовый класс для Дто показателя.

Inheritance
EntityDto
EntityCodeDto
IndicatorDto
DataIndicatorDto
DictionaryIndicatorDto
TransformedIndicatorDto
VirtualIndicatorDto
Inherited Members
EntityCodeDto.Code
EntityDto.Id
EntityDto.Name
Namespace: Trivium.IndicatorsDto
Assembly: Trivium.IndicatorsDto.dll
Syntax
[JsonConverter(typeof(JsonInheritanceConverter), new object[]{"discriminator"})]
[KnownType("GetKnownTypes")]
public abstract class IndicatorDto : EntityCodeDto

Properties

LockIndicatorSettingsDto EditLockIndicatorSettings
Настройки блокировки данных показателя по данным другого показателя на редактирование.
List<IndicatorFactOptionsDto> FactOptions
Коллекция настроек для фактов показателя.
Если измерения фактов нет (для старых DataIndicator или VirtuaIndicator), можно задавать FactId = -1.
List<IndicatorDictionaryDto> IndicatorDictionaries
Коллекция справочников показателя.
bool IsAccessRightsEnabled
Признак включения прав на доступ к данным показателя.
bool IsCached
Кэшируемый ли показатель.
bool IsDataSourceExternal
Признак, являетя ли источник данных внешним (например: view).
По сути данный признак говорит о том, что мы игнорируем работу с источником данных (таблицей) т.к. он внешний.
bool IsReadonly
Показатель только для чтения - не записывает данные в хранилище.
LockIndicatorSettingsDto ReadLockIndicatorSettings
Настройки блокировки данных показателя по данным другого показателя на чтение.
Back to top Generated by DocFX